  16. package cloudstack
  17. import (
  18. "encoding/json"
  19. "fmt"
  20. "net/url"
  21. "strconv"
  22. "strings"
  23. )
  24. type CreateLoadBalancerRuleParams struct {
  25. p map[string]interface{}
  26. }
  27. func (p *CreateLoadBalancerRuleParams) toURLValues() url.Values {
  28. u := url.Values{}
  29. if p.p == nil {
  30. return u
  31. }
  32. if v, found := p.p["account"]; found {
  33. u.Set("account", v.(string))
  34. }
  35. if v, found := p.p["algorithm"]; found {
  36. u.Set("algorithm", v.(string))
  37. }
  38. if v, found := p.p["cidrlist"]; found {
  39. vv := strings.Join(v.([]string), ",")
  40. u.Set("cidrlist", vv)
  41. }
  42. if v, found := p.p["description"]; found {
  43. u.Set("description", v.(string))
  44. }
  45. if v, found := p.p["domainid"]; found {
  46. u.Set("domainid", v.(string))
  47. }
  48. if v, found := p.p["fordisplay"]; found {
  49. vv := strconv.FormatBool(v.(bool))
  50. u.Set("fordisplay", vv)
  51. }
  52. if v, found := p.p["name"]; found {
  53. u.Set("name", v.(string))
  54. }
  55. if v, found := p.p["networkid"]; found {
  56. u.Set("networkid", v.(string))
  57. }
  58. if v, found := p.p["openfirewall"]; found {
  59. vv := strconv.FormatBool(v.(bool))
  60. u.Set("openfirewall", vv)
  61. }
  62. if v, found := p.p["privateport"]; found {
  63. vv := strconv.Itoa(v.(int))
  64. u.Set("privateport", vv)
  65. }
  66. if v, found := p.p["protocol"]; found {
  67. u.Set("protocol", v.(string))
  68. }
  69. if v, found := p.p["publicipid"]; found {
  70. u.Set("publicipid", v.(string))
  71. }
  72. if v, found := p.p["publicport"]; found {
  73. vv := strconv.Itoa(v.(int))
  74. u.Set("publicport", vv)
  75. }
  76. if v, found := p.p["zoneid"]; found {
  77. u.Set("zoneid", v.(string))
  78. }
  79. return u
  80. }
  81. func (p *CreateLoadBalancerRuleParams) SetAccount(v string) {
  82. if p.p == nil {
  83. p.p = make(map[string]interface{})
  84. }
  85. p.p["account"] = v
  86. return
  87. }
  88. func (p *CreateLoadBalancerRuleParams) SetAlgorithm(v string) {
  89. if p.p == nil {
  90. p.p = make(map[string]interface{})
  91. }
  92. p.p["algorithm"] = v
  93. return
  94. }
  95. func (p *CreateLoadBalancerRuleParams) SetCidrlist(v []string) {
  96. if p.p == nil {
  97. p.p = make(map[string]interface{})
  98. }
  99. p.p["cidrlist"] = v
  100. return
  101. }
  102. func (p *CreateLoadBalancerRuleParams) SetDescription(v string) {
  103. if p.p == nil {
  104. p.p = make(map[string]interface{})
  105. }
  106. p.p["description"] = v
  107. return
  108. }
  109. func (p *CreateLoadBalancerRuleParams) SetDomainid(v string) {
  110. if p.p == nil {
  111. p.p = make(map[string]interface{})
  112. }
  113. p.p["domainid"] = v
  114. return
  115. }
  116. func (p *CreateLoadBalancerRuleParams) SetFordisplay(v bool) {
  117. if p.p == nil {
  118. p.p = make(map[string]interface{})
  119. }
  120. p.p["fordisplay"] = v
  121. return
  122. }
  123. func (p *CreateLoadBalancerRuleParams) SetName(v string) {
  124. if p.p == nil {
  125. p.p = make(map[string]interface{})
  126. }
  127. p.p["name"] = v
  128. return
  129. }
  130. func (p *CreateLoadBalancerRuleParams) SetNetworkid(v string) {
  131. if p.p == nil {
  132. p.p = make(map[string]interface{})
  133. }
  134. p.p["networkid"] = v
  135. return
  136. }
  137. func (p *CreateLoadBalancerRuleParams) SetOpenfirewall(v bool) {
  138. if p.p == nil {
  139. p.p = make(map[string]interface{})
  140. }
  141. p.p["openfirewall"] = v
  142. return
  143. }
  144. func (p *CreateLoadBalancerRuleParams) SetPrivateport(v int) {
  145. if p.p == nil {
  146. p.p = make(map[string]interface{})
  147. }
  148. p.p["privateport"] = v
  149. return
  150. }
  151. func (p *CreateLoadBalancerRuleParams) SetProtocol(v string) {
  152. if p.p == nil {
  153. p.p = make(map[string]interface{})
  154. }
  155. p.p["protocol"] = v
  156. return
  157. }
  158. func (p *CreateLoadBalancerRuleParams) SetPublicipid(v string) {
  159. if p.p == nil {
  160. p.p = make(map[string]interface{})
  161. }
  162. p.p["publicipid"] = v
  163. return
  164. }
  165. func (p *CreateLoadBalancerRuleParams) SetPublicport(v int) {
  166. if p.p == nil {
  167. p.p = make(map[string]interface{})
  168. }
  169. p.p["publicport"] = v
  170. return
  171. }
  172. func (p *CreateLoadBalancerRuleParams) SetZoneid(v string) {
  173. if p.p == nil {
  174. p.p = make(map[string]interface{})
  175. }
  176. p.p["zoneid"] = v
  177. return
  178. }
  179. // You should always use this function to get a new CreateLoadBalancerRuleParams instance,
  180. // as then you are sure you have configured all required params
  181. func (s *LoadBalancerService) NewCreateLoadBalancerRuleParams(algorithm string, name string, privateport int, publicport int) *CreateLoadBalancerRuleParams {
  182. p := &CreateLoadBalancerRuleParams{}
  183. p.p = make(map[string]interface{})
  184. p.p["algorithm"] = algorithm
  185. p.p["name"] = name
  186. p.p["privateport"] = privateport
  187. p.p["publicport"] = publicport
  188. return p
  189. }
  190. // Creates a load balancer rule
  191. func (s *LoadBalancerService) CreateLoadBalancerRule(p *CreateLoadBalancerRuleParams) (*CreateLoadBalancerRuleResponse, error) {
  192. resp, err := s.cs.newRequest("createLoadBalancerRule", p.toURLValues())
  193. if err != nil {
  194. return nil, err
  195. }
  196. var r CreateLoadBalancerRuleResponse
  197. if err := json.Unmarshal(resp, &r); err != nil {
  198. return nil, err
  199. }
  200. // If we have a async client, we need to wait for the async result
  201. if s.cs.async {
  202. b, err := s.cs.GetAsyncJobResult(r.JobID, s.cs.timeout)
  203. if err != nil {
  204. if err == AsyncTimeoutErr {
  205. return &r, err
  206. }
  207. return nil, err
  208. }
  209. b, err = getRawValue(b)
  210. if err != nil {
  211. return nil, err
  212. }
  213. if err := json.Unmarshal(b, &r); err != nil {
  214. return nil, err
  215. }
  216. }
  217. return &r, nil
  218. }
  219. type CreateLoadBalancerRuleResponse struct {
  220. JobID string `json:"jobid,omitempty"`
  221. Account string `json:"account,omitempty"`
  222. Algorithm string `json:"algorithm,omitempty"`
  223. Cidrlist string `json:"cidrlist,omitempty"`
  224. Description string `json:"description,omitempty"`
  225. Domain string `json:"domain,omitempty"`
  226. Domainid string `json:"domainid,omitempty"`
  227. Fordisplay bool `json:"fordisplay,omitempty"`
  228. Id string `json:"id,omitempty"`
  229. Name string `json:"name,omitempty"`
  230. Networkid string `json:"networkid,omitempty"`
  231. Privateport string `json:"privateport,omitempty"`
  232. Project string `json:"project,omitempty"`
  233. Projectid string `json:"projectid,omitempty"`
  234. Protocol string `json:"protocol,omitempty"`
  235. Publicip string `json:"publicip,omitempty"`
  236. Publicipid string `json:"publicipid,omitempty"`
  237. Publicport string `json:"publicport,omitempty"`
  238. State string `json:"state,omitempty"`
  239. Tags []struct {
  240. Account string `json:"account,omitempty"`
  241. Customer string `json:"customer,omitempty"`
  242. Domain string `json:"domain,omitempty"`
  243. Domainid string `json:"domainid,omitempty"`
  244. Key string `json:"key,omitempty"`
  245. Project string `json:"project,omitempty"`
  246. Projectid string `json:"projectid,omitempty"`
  247. Resourceid string `json:"resourceid,omitempty"`
  248. Resourcetype string `json:"resourcetype,omitempty"`
  249. Value string `json:"value,omitempty"`
  250. } `json:"tags,omitempty"`
  251. Zoneid string `json:"zoneid,omitempty"`
  252. }
